I have had chronic back pain the last 12 years after 5 operations and numerous epederal shots they are trying to control the pain with meds I have been on the oxycodone for the last 6 or 7 months and the effect is not as long lasting as when we changed meds from morphine 25 mg i take 5 pills in a24 hr period but the breakthrough pain at night keeps from sleeping more than 1 or 2 at a time so I have been using tylenol but it upsets my stomach to the of vomiting I took about 5000 or 6000 mg in the last 18 hrs because i don't want to take to much of oxycodone. when i was on the morphine my doctor gave me percocet 10/325 for breakthrough but we quit that when i started the oxycodone.I do take Omerprazole but when I took my meds this morning everything came back up
doctor
Answered by Dr. T Chandrakant (3 hours later)
Brief Answer:
you need to go to the ER

Detailed Answer:
Thanks for your feedback.

Please note that more than 4000 mg of Tylenol is not allowed in 24 hours and that is why you may be getting the vomiting.

Please do not take Tylenol at the moment at all.

You can certainly go to ER so that they can give you some other medication for the pain may be by intramuscular route or so.

I'd suggest getting a prompt review of the situation there so that the symptoms are controlled as early as possible.
